Discover exceptional value at Dorset Tower Condos, 1950 Kennedy Rd. This bright and spacious 2-bedroom, 1-bath suite features an open-concept living and dining area with sleek laminate flooring, a modern kitchen with quartz-style counters, stainless steel appliances, and a deep pantry. Both bedrooms offer large closets, ensuring plenty of in-suite storage, plus an ensuite locker adds even more convenience.Unlike many condos in this price range, this well-managed and secure building offers lower maintenance fees per square foot, which already include heat, water, cable TV, and high-speed interneta rare advantage for cost-conscious buyers. Amenities include an exercise room, sauna, party/meeting room, playground, and ample visitor parking.Perfectly located just steps to Kennedy Commons shopping (Costco, Metro, Starbucks, LA Fitness, restaurants, and more), with quick access to Hwy 401 and convenient TTC connections via Kennedy subway and bus routes. A smart choice for first-time buyers, downsizers, or investors looking for comfort, convenience, and long-term value across the GTA.

Who lives here?

Dorset Park,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from the Philippines, India and Sri Lanka, and Tagalog and Tamil spe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 40 to 64.
